Recent Advances in the Pathogenesis of Autoimmune Hair Loss Disease Alopecia Areata
Alopecia areata is considered to be a cell-mediated autoimmune disease, in which autoreactive cytotoxic T cells recognize melanocyte-associated proteins such as tyrosinase. This review discusses recent advances in the understanding of the pathogenesis of alopecia areata, focusing on immunobiology and hormonal aspects of hair follicles (HFs). متن کاملLymphocytes, neuropeptides, and genes involved in alopecia areata.
Many lessons in autoimmunity - particularly relating to the role of immune privilege and the interplay between genetics and neuroimmunology - can be learned from the study of alopecia areata, the most common cause of inflammation-induced hair loss. متن کاملSuccessful hair transplant of eyebrow alopecia areata.
BACKGROUND Alopecia areata of the eyebrows can be difficult to treat. Intralesional triamcinolone or potent topical steroids are considered the mainstay of medical therapy. This case illustrates the results of an experimental hair transplant to the eyebrows following years of modest response to intralesional triamcinolone. متن کاملAlopecia Areata (AA, Patchy Hair Loss) — Causes and Treatment
Alopecia areata is a non-scarring hair loss disorder that can occur in any part of the body, ranging from a small patch to complete loss of hair, without significant age or sex predisposition. Although the exact etiology is unknown, several patient-specific genetic, immunological, and environmental factors have been implicated.
